Just checked the Wholesale checker again, its become almost habitual now, and its now showing results for my exact address as well as my postcode!
WBC FTTC Up to 67.6 Up to 20 -- 31-Dec-13

I'm very happy with that estimate which is a tenfold increase on what we currently get, though part of me hopes that estimate is conservative laugh

On a side note my cabinet, 26, had a lone engineer working on it today. Not sure what exactly he was doing, but he seemed to be fiddling with the cabinets innards. My guess is that maybe he was splicing the new fibre in or connecting the PCP and Fibre Cab together. The PCP also has two perfectly shaped stars marked on in white, is this OR marking? These have been here for as long as I can remember, but I only actually thought of why they might be there today.
